Juanes, Ford Give Power to Your Voice
Ford Motor Company and Colombian Rocker Get SYNC-ronized
DEARBORN, Mich., October 22, 2007 – Your voice now gives you the power to control your phone and mp3 player inside your car. Ford Motor Company is introducing, a new factory-installed, in-car communications and entertainment system that uses voice commands to access your Bluetooth-enabled mobile phone, digital music player and, when paired to a compatible mobile phone, will even reads your text messages.
SYNC, a Ford-exclusive technology based on Microsoft Auto software, provides consumers with the convenience of using their voice to command their car to do everything from playing their favorite songs to calling their favorite person. By pushing a button on your vehicles steering wheel and then saying a command, users can access their Bluetooth-activated mobile phone and digital music player – including genre, album, artist and song title. The idea is focused on extending the digital lifestyle and connecting your experiences to your car.

Available in 12 2008 Ford, Lincoln and Mercury models this calendar year and in nearly every Ford, Lincoln and Mercury product within two years, SYNC’s voice recognition system has settings for English, Spanish and French. Pending the capability of individual devices, SYNC features include voice-activated hands-free calling; Bluetooth streaming audio; uninterrupted connections; audible text messages; voice-activated music; automatic phonebook transfer and multilingual intelligence. SYNC is compatible with most Bluetooth-enabled mobile phones and most digital media players, including the Apple iPod and Microsoft Zune.

Juanes
A top-selling Latin Rock artist, Juanes has become the leading all-Spanish language music artist in the world. A dedicated global activist and renowned musician Juanes has won 12 Latin Grammy awards and has been declared “the single most important figure of the past decade in Latin pop music” by the Los Angeles Times and “One of the 100 Most Influential People in the World” by Time Magazine. His second album Un Dia Normal became the #1 Spanish-language album for all of 2003 in both sales and airplay and still holds the record for the longest Top-10 chart run (92 weeks) of any Latin album in history. The album’s success led Juanes to top six separate Billboard year-end Latin charts, including #1 album, #1 singles artist and #1 songwriter and resulted in his selection for the cover of Billboards “Year in Music” special issue.
